fix(handlers): wire all 37 fields in UpdateMediaItem, add cover upload support

UpdateMediaItem handler:
- Add form: tags to UpdateMediaItemRequest for dual JSON/multipart binding
- Add 8 missing fields (Language, Edition, PageCount, Genre, CopyrightYear,
  GoodreadsID, OpenlibraryID, GoogleBooksID)
- Add CoverAction field (keep/upload/remove) with multipart cover handling
- Fetch existing record before update to preserve cover_image_path when
  cover_action is "keep" (was clearing cover on every JSON save)
- Add saveCoverImage() method: validates image type, resolves library path,
  saves as {file_path}.cover.jpg
- Add HX-Redirect response header for HTMX clients

HandleBulkUpdate:
- Copy all 37 fields from existingMedia (was missing GoogleBooksID + 14
  new fields), preventing data loss on bulk metadata updates.

func (mh *MediaHandler) saveCoverImage(c echo.Context, mediaUUID uuid.UUID, file *multipart.FileHeader) (string, error) {
src, err := file.Open()
if err != nil {
return "", fmt.Errorf("failed to open uploaded file: %w", err)
}
defer src.Close()
imageData, err := io.ReadAll(src)
if err != nil {
return "", fmt.Errorf("failed to read uploaded file: %w", err)
}
if len(imageData) < 512 {
return "", fmt.Errorf("file too small to be a valid image")
}
contentType := http.DetectContentType(imageData)
if contentType != "image/jpeg" && contentType != "image/png" && contentType != "image/webp" {
return "", fmt.Errorf("invalid image type: %s", contentType)
}
mediaItem, err := mh.db.GetMediaItem(c.Request().Context(), pgtype.UUID{Bytes: mediaUUID, Valid: true})
if err != nil {
return "", fmt.Errorf("media item not found: %w", err)
}
relativeFilePath := mediaItem.FilePath
if relativeFilePath == "" {
return "", fmt.Errorf("media item has no file path")
}
coverRelPath := relativeFilePath + ".cover.jpg"
coverFullPath, err := mh.libraryService.ResolveMediaPath(c.Request().Context(), mediaItem.LibraryID, coverRelPath)
if err != nil {
return "", fmt.Errorf("failed to resolve cover path: %w", err)
}
coverDir := filepath.Dir(coverFullPath)
if err := os.MkdirAll(coverDir, 0755); err != nil {
return "", fmt.Errorf("failed to create cover directory: %w", err)
}
if err := os.WriteFile(coverFullPath, imageData, 0644); err != nil {
return "", fmt.Errorf("failed to write cover file: %w", err)
}
return coverRelPath, nil
}
